In a series examining trade history with different MLB teams, the Royals and Rockies have engaged in 10 trades since 2001, with the first deal involving Sal Fasano and Mac Suzuki for Brent Mayne.

By the Numbers
  • The Royals and Rockies have made a total of 10 trades since 2001.
  • Best Trade: The Royals traded Jonathan Sanchez for Jeremy Guthrie in 2012.
Yes, But

Some trades, like the one involving Jermaine Dye and Neifi Perez, have been viewed as significant missteps by the Royals.
